On Mon, Jan 10, 2005 at 10:27:06AM +0100, Heiko Carstens wrote:
> Hmm.. then maybe you could explain to me how e.g.
> drivers/usb/serial/usb-serial.c does this right and keeps the release
> function from being called after usb-serial.ko got unloaded?
usb-serial can not get unloaded if there is a reference held on a sysfs
file owned by it, or if a user has a port open. This is due to the
module reference counting logic in sysfs attributes, and in the module
reference count stuff in the usb-serial core itself.
Unless I'm missing something, and if so, please let me know and I'll go
fix it up.
